The National Institute of Standards and Technology (NIST) Dimensional Metrology Group (DMG), located in Gaithersburg, MD, delivers world class dimensional calibration services to support United States manufacturing and other industries. Of particular importance is the calibration of spheres, which serve as reference objects to universal length measuring machines and coordinate measurement machines used internally at NIST and by customers. The NIST DMG is seeking a camera-based Fizeau interferometer to replace ageing equipment responsible for the calibration of the diameter of spheres. The Department of Commerce, National Institute of Standards and Technology (NIST) is soliciting a firm fixed price contract under solicitation 1333ND26QNB610462 for the procurement of eighty-five new neutron proportional counters for the POLAR polarizing cold neutron triple axis spectrometer. The contractor must provide detectors meeting specific mechanical and electrical requirements, including an 8 mm outer diameter, 150 mm active length, and 90 percent sensitivity for 5 meV neutrons using a 3He/CO2/Ar gas mixture. Key deliverables include the detectors, approved design drawings, and a detailed Bill of Materials. All items must be new, and the contractor must provide a one-year warranty. Delivery is specified as FOB Destination to the NIST Center for Neutron Research in Gaithersburg, Maryland. Amendment 0001 significantly modifies the delivery schedule, extending the lead time from four months after receipt of order to fifty-two weeks. The award will be based on the Lowest Price Technically Acceptable (LPTA) basis, where technical capability is evaluated as pass/fail before price is considered. Offerors must submit their quotations in three separate volumes covering technical specifications, pricing, and terms and conditions by August 17, 2026. Administrative requirements include electronic invoicing via the Invoice Processing Platform (IPP) and strict adherence to NIST site access and operational compliance protocols.
